We’re so excited to see Middlebury College graduate Corrine Prevot and her company Skida listed today! Skida has been making Nordic and Alpine hats, neck warmers, headbands, and more in Vermont’s Northeast Kingdom since their start in 2007. Owner Corrine Prevot saw a need for functional, warm, and fashionable gear for her teammates and friends at the Burke Mountain Ski Academy and since then her hobby has turned into a worldwide business. Find products in every color and for everyone on your list. Skida recently launched their new line of products for kids and their fabrics are fun and eye catching.
